Ingredients You’ll Need
Let’s gather our simple and wholesome ingredients for this recipe. They come together beautifully to create a comforting meal that warms both your heart and stomach!
For the Chicken
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 1 packet ranch seasoning mix
- 1 can (10.5 ounces) cream of chicken soup
- 1/2 cup chicken broth
- 1/2 cup sour cream
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
- 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
For Cooking
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
For Topping
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- Fresh parsley, chopped, for garnish

How to Make Ranch Chicken Crock Pot
Step 1: Sear the Chicken
If enhanced flavor is desired, start by heating ol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Searing the chicken breasts until golden on both sides adds depth and richness to your dish. This step isn’t mandatory but trust me—it makes a difference!
Step 2: Prepare the Sauce
In your trusty crockpot, combine the cream of chicken soup, ranch seasoning mix, chicken broth, garlic powder, onion powder, and black pepper. Stir everything together until smooth. This will create a flavorful sauce that perfectly coats your chicken.
Step 3: Add the Chicken
Place the seared chicken breasts into the crockpot. Make sure they are well coated with that delicious sauce mixture you just created. This will ensure every bite is packed with flavor!
Step 4: Cook Low and Slow
Cover your crockpot and cook on low for 6 to 7 hours or on high for 3 to 4 hours until the chicken is fully cooked and tender. Cooking it slowly allows all those flavors to meld beautifully together.
Step 5: Shred the Chicken
Once cooked, carefully shred the chicken using two forks right inside the crockpot. Mixing it back into that luscious sauce ensures every piece is deliciously coated.
Step 6: Finish with Creaminess
Stir in sour cream until smooth and creamy. If you’re feeling indulgent, sprinkle shredded cheddar on top along with fresh parsley before serving—this will add an extra layer of flavor that’s hard to resist!

Make Ahead and Storage
This Ranch Chicken Crock Pot recipe is perfect for meal prep, allowing you to enjoy delicious, comforting meals throughout the week with minimal effort.
Storing Leftovers
- Allow the chicken to cool completely before storing.
- Transfer any leftovers into an airtight container.
- Refrigerate for up to 3-4 days.
Freezing
- Let the Ranch Chicken cool completely before freezing.
- Place in a freezer-safe container or a resealable plastic bag, removing as much air as possible.
- Freeze for up to 2-3 months for best quality.
Reheating
- Thaw frozen chicken in the refrigerator overnight before reheating.
- Reheat leftovers in a microwave-safe dish until heated through, about 2-3 minutes on high.
- Alternatively, warm in a saucepan over low heat until hot, stirring occasionally.

Can I use chicken thighs instead of breasts in the Ranch Chicken Crock Pot?
Yes! You can definitely substitute chicken thighs for chicken breasts. Just be aware that cooking times might vary slightly due to the different fat content.
How do I make Ranch Chicken Crock Pot spicier?
To add some heat, consider mixing in a teaspoon of cayenne pepper or adding diced jalapeños to the sauce mixture before cooking.
Can I use homemade ranch seasoning for my Ranch Chicken Crock Pot?
Absolutely! Using homemade ranch seasoning is a great way to customize flavors. Just ensure it has similar ingredients to what’s found in store-bought mixes.
